How Dangerous Are the Roads in Broken Arrow, Oklahoma?

Broken Arrow has a Road Danger Score of 27/100 (Safer Roads Than Most Cities). Over the most recent five-year period, federal crash data recorded 27 fatal motor-vehicle crashes in the city, killing 31 people — 5.1 traffic deaths per 100,000 residents per year, below the national average of 12.3.

Broken Arrow ranks #36 out of 42 ranked cities in Oklahoma and #1,577 out of 2,153 nationally for road danger (most dangerous first). The score is a percentile: a higher traffic-fatality rate than about 27% of ranked US cities.

The most distinctive factor in Broken Arrow's fatal crashes: drinking driver involved — 41% of fatal crashes, versus 26% nationally.

Traffic deaths in Broken Arrow fell 7% comparing the first two years of the period with the most recent two years.

What’s Behind Broken Arrow’s Fatal Crashes

Share of the city’s 27 fatal crashes where each factor was recorded. Factors overlap, so shares don’t sum to 100%.

Crash Factor Fatal Crashes Broken Arrow National Avg
Drinking driver involved 11 40.7% 25.9%
Speeding involved 8 29.6% 28.2%
Pedestrian or cyclist involved 3 11.1% 22.5%
Dark / nighttime conditions 17 63.0% 49.8%
